حَدَّثَنَا عَبْدُ اللَّهِ بْنُ مُحَمَّدٍ ، ثنا هَارُونُ بْنُ عَبْدِ اللَّهِ ، ثنا يَزِيدُ بْنُ هَارُونَ ، ثنا حَمَّادُ بْنُ سَلَمَةَ ، عَنْ ثَابِتٍ الْبُنَانِيِّ ، عَنْ عَبْدِ اللَّهِ بْنِ رَبَاحٍ ، عَنْ أَبِي قَتَادَةَ ، عَنِ النَّبِيِّ صَلَّى اللَّهُ عَلَيْهِ وَسَلَّمَ ، قَالَ : " إِنْ كَانَ أَمْرُ دُنْيَاكُمْ فَشَأْنُكُمْ ، وَإِنْ كَانَ أَمْرُ دِينِكُمْ فَإِلَيَّ " ، فَقُلْنَا : يَا رَسُولَ اللَّهِ ، فَرَّطْنَا فِي صَلاتِنَا ، فَقَالَ : " لا تَفْرِيطَ فِي النَّوْمِ ، إِنَّمَا التَّفْرِيطُ فِي الْيَقَظَةِ ، فَإِذَا كَانَ ذَلِكَ فَصَلُّوهَا وَمِنَ الْغَدِ لِوَقْتِهَا " .
Sayyiduna Abu Qatadah (may Allah be pleased with him) narrates that the Noble Prophet (peace and blessings be upon him) said: "If it is a worldly matter of yours, then it is your concern, and if it is a religious matter, then it will come to me." We submitted: O Messenger of Allah! We sometimes fall short regarding our prayers. The Noble Prophet (peace and blessings be upon him) said: "There is no negligence in sleeping; negligence is in wakefulness. When such a situation occurs, then perform that prayer (after waking up) or perform it at its time on the next day."
